About This Show

Nu Deco Ensemble returns to the Arsht to close out their 2025-26 season with a dazzling program that bridges cosmic wonder and disco brilliance, featuring guest artists Wyclef Jean and Ledisi. Gustav Holst’s iconic The Planets is paired with a vibrant new symphonic suite inspired by the legendary music of the Bee Gees—created by Nu Deco’s writing cohort and Steve Gibb, acclaimed guitarist and son of Bee Gees icon Barry Gibb, who will join the ensemble for the performance of the suite. With Wyclef’s genre-defying sound and Ledisi’s powerhouse vocals woven into the program, this season finale promises an unforgettable evening of musical imagination, celebration, and finale-worthy flair.

Ledisi

full

Ledisi, a Grammy-winning vocalist, has wowed fans with her unparalleled vocals for over twenty years. Ledisi is also a songwriter, author, actress, music producer, film producer, publisher, educator, and record company executive.

Growing up, Ledisi was heavily influenced by many soulful music icons, but especially Dr. Nina Simone. Ledisi, in 2021, released her dream project on her label entitled, “Ledisi Sings Nina” with the Metropole Orkest conducted by Jules Buckley and The New Orleans Jazz Orchestra conducted by Adonis Rose. This tour de force jazz project garnered Ledisi her 14th Grammy nomination and received rave reviews, prompting John Legend to say, In terms of her range, dexterity, clarity, and versatility, she can do anything she wants. She’s one of the great singers in the world, period.”

In addition to a Grammy win and nominations, Ledisi has garnered three Soul Train Music Awards, 19 NAACP Image Award Nominations, an NAACP Theatre Award, and an NAACP nomination for Breakthrough Performance in a Film for her role as Mahalia Jackson in Remember Me. Ledisi also received two LA Alliance Ovation Award Nominations, one for Best Featured Actress in a Musical.
